About the Role

We are seeking a dynamic and highly organized Account Manager to support our strategic OEM partnerships. In this hybrid role, you’ll act as the primary liaison between Platform Science and leading OEM partners, owning relationships from onboarding through maturity. You’ll coordinate cross-functional efforts to ensure partner success, optimize joint initiatives, and deliver against complex program goals.

The ideal candidate thrives at the intersection of strategic account management and project execution, is tech-savvy, and possesses outstanding communication and problem-solving skills.

Essential Responsibilities

  • Serve as the main point of contact for assigned OEM partner accounts, building strong, trust-based relationships across both executive and operational levels.
  • Lead the planning and execution of joint initiatives, ensuring clarity in roles, deliverables, and timelines across internal and partner teams.
  • Track and communicate partner requirements, feedback, and performance metrics internally to ensure alignment and timely resolution of issues.
  • Facilitate cross-functional collaboration across Engineering, Product, Marketing, Legal, and Support to support partner needs.
  • Develop quarterly business reviews (QBRs), status updates, and partner roadmaps.
  • Maintain accurate records of activities and status via CRM and internal reporting tools.

About Platform Science

Platform Science offers a configurable open platform for the transportation industry, focusing on telematics and fleet management solutions. Their products include a connected vehicle platform, mobile device management, and a fleet management portal, which help large fleet operators transition from outdated systems to more advanced technology. These tools enable fleet operators to manage mobile devices and applications, monitor operations, and ensure safety and maintenance through a single portal. Unlike competitors, Platform Science emphasizes ease of use and quick deployment, making it accessible for clients. The goal is to enhance efficiency, improve the driver experience, and provide future-proof solutions for fleet management.
